Meeting Frida

We met in Budapest, on October 2018, 64 years after her death at her retrospective exhibition.

The brutal honesty of the art touched a raw nerve, an instant mirror reflecting my troubled state of mind. Frida’s self-portraits became mine, their guarded expression concealing layers of restrained emotions and unspoken words.

Meeting Frida” images emerged from the darkroom into the sun filled studio where burning shades of gold, amber, and red take over the black and white palette. Imperfections are accepted, even embraced. In life as in art.

Continuing my exploration of combining historical and contemporary photographic processes, in this portfolio, I create digital collages using iPhone and traditional camera images. Using digital negatives the final images are printed as Silver Gelatin Lith prints with Chromoskedastic Sabattier.
